On deployment the division was assigned to the III Corps Tactical Zone of Vietnam where it commenced operations in Dinh Tuong and Long An Provinces (6 January-31 May 1967) in Operation Palm Beach. Operating deep within the Viet Cong (VC)–controlled Delta, the Division was charged with protecting the area and its population against VC insurgents and ensuring the success of the South Vietnamese government's pacification program. Though it was inactivated, the division was identified as the second highest priority inactive division in the United States Army Center of Military History's lineage scheme due to its numerous accolades and long history. Should the U.S. Army decide to activate more divisions in the future, the center will most likely suggest the first new division be the 9th Infantry Division, the second be the 24th Infantry Division, the third be the 5th Infantry Division. The division formed part of Indian III Corps in the Malaya Command during the Battle of Malaya. This division is the most strategic important formation of the Bangladesh Army as it is entrusted with the responsibility of security of Dhaka, the capital of Bangladesh. 9th Infantry Division was raised on 20 November 1976 [citation needed] in Dhaka cantonment as the first division of the Bangladesh Army.
